Scorecard of India Vs West Indies at Wellington (March 10): Benson & Hedges World Cup 1992

Related Links : Benson & Hedges World Cup 1992 | World Cups Homepage | India Player Pages | West Indies Player Pages

Match Date : March 10, 1992
Venue : Basin Reserve, Wellington
Toss : India won the toss and elected to bat first
Umpires : SG Randell and SJ Woodward
Match Result : West Indies won by 5 wkts
Man of the Match : Andy Cummins

India (50 Overs Maximum)

Ajay Jadeja c Benjamin b Simmons 27 (61) 2 ‘4s’
Krish Srikkanth c Logie b Hooper 40 (70) 2 ‘4s’
M Azharuddin (C) c Ambrose b Cummins 61 (84) 4 ‘4s’
Sachin Tendulkar c Williams b Ambrose 4 (11)
Sanjay Manjrekar run out 27 (40)
Kapil Dev c Haynes b Cummins 3 (4)
Pravin Amre c Hooper b Ambrose 4 (8)
Kiran More (WK) c Hooper b Cummins 5 (5) 1 ‘4s’
Manoj Prabhakar c Richardson b Cummins 8 (10) 1 ‘4s’
Javagal Srinath not out 5 (5)
Venkatapathy Raju run out 1 (1)

Extras : 12 (Wides: 5 No Balls: 1 Byes: 0 Leg Byes: 6)

Total : 197 all out (Overs: 49.4)

Fall of Wickets : 1-56 (Jadeja), 2-102 (Srikkanth), 3-115 (Tendulkar), 4-166 (Azharuddin), 5-171 (Kapil Dev), 6-173 (Manjrekar), 7-180 (More), 8-186 (Amre), 9-193 (Prabhakar), 10-197 (Raju)

West Indies Bowling

Ambrose 10-1-24-2
Benjamin 9.4-0-35-0 (4wd)
Cummins 10-0-33-4
Simmons 9-0-48-1 (1wd 1nb)
Hooper 10-0-46-1
Arthurton 1-0-5-0

West Indies (Revised Target: 195 from 46 Overs)

Desmond Haynes c Manjrekar b Kapil Dev 16 (16) 3 ‘4s’
Brian Lara c Manjrekar b Srinath 41 (37) 6 ‘4s’ 1 ‘6s’
Phil Simmons c Tendulkar b Prabhakar 22 (20) 2 ‘4s’ 1 ‘6s’
R Richardson (C) c Srikkanth b Srinath 3 (8)
Keith Arthurton not out 58 (99) 3 ‘4s’
Gus Logie c More b Raju 7 (10) 1 ‘4s’
Carl Hooper not out 34 (57) 3 ‘4s’
David Williams (WK)
Andy Cummins
Curtly Ambrose
Winston Benjamin

Extras : 14 (Wides: 2 No Balls: 4 Byes: 0 Leg Byes: 8)

Total : 195/5 (Overs: 40.2)

Fall of Wickets : 1-57 (Haynes), 2-81 (Lara), 3-88 (Simmons), 4-98 (Richardson), 5-112 (Logie)

India Bowling

Kapil Dev 8-0-45-1
Prabhakar 9-0-55-1 (1wd 1nb)
Raju 10-2-32-1 (1wd)
Srinath 9-2-23-2 (3nb)
Tendulkar 3-0-20-0
Srikkanth 1-0-7-0
Jadeja 0.2-0-5-0
